For PC repair and background, I recommend "Upgrading and Repairing PCs", by Scott Mueller. Should be up to the 16th or 17th edition now. For $50 it's cheap for what you get! Cram-packed full of info.
Another good one is "PC Hardware in a Nutshell" by Fritchman. A no-BS book that names the best parts to get.
